Experience the ultimate luxury safari across Uganda, where breathtaking landscapes and extraordinary wildlife encounters create unforgettable memories. Begin your journey at Ziwa Sanctuary, tracking rare white rhinos in their protected habitat, a thrilling introduction to Uganda’s commitment to conservation. Continue to Murchison Falls, where powerful waterfalls and sweeping savannahs provide the perfect backdrop for exciting game drives and a relaxing Nile cruise. Each moment combines adventure with comfort, allowing you to immerse yourself fully in Uganda’s natural beauty while enjoying handpicked luxury accommodations.
Discover the rich biodiversity of Uganda as your safari continues to Kibale Forest for an intimate chimpanzee trek, followed by exploration of Queen Elizabeth National Park, where elephants, lions, and hippos roam freely. Learn to appreciate the tranquility of Lake Bunyonyi, a serene setting to unwind after days filled with adventure. Explore the misty forests of Bwindi for an awe-inspiring mountain gorilla trek, a once-in-a-lifetime encounter that leaves a lasting impression. This journey blends thrilling wildlife experiences with luxurious comfort, offering a harmonious balance of adventure, relaxation, and unforgettable African landscapes.
